Output 8b7fa631c3490c9258786a3381a018f18f261ecb09738b54256e2d15d9ae3310:0

value
1096531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98355c7d4c05c14da0dac59d60fa4e7fd0581b98 OP_EQUALVERIFY OP_CHECKSIG
address
1EsodmPvYEr1P5tHj434fPRra4CTvQtA2i
transaction
8b7fa631c3490c9258786a3381a018f18f261ecb09738b54256e2d15d9ae3310
confirmations
542523
spent
true